The cost for a house extension in Ellesmere Port typically ranges from £1,200 to £2,500 per square metre in 2026. The final price can vary based on factors such as the type of extension, materials used, and complexity of the project. For example, a standard single-storey extension could cost around £20,000 to £40,000, while a larger, more complex two-storey extension might start at £45,000 and go up to £75,000 or more.
It's vital to ensure that your builder is properly certified. Look for professionals who are registered with the Federation of Master Builders (FMB) or hold relevant qualifications in building regulations. Additionally, if your project involves gas appliances, ensure your contractor is Gas Safe registered.
For loft conversions, which can also be a great way to add space, you might expect costs to start around £30,000 for a basic conversion, depending on the specifics of the build.
